In Indiana, home warranty costs generally range from $30 to $99 monthly, depending on the plan and company.
Jump to insightDue to Indiana's diverse weather, you’ll probably want to look for home warranty plans that include robust HVAC coverage.
Jump to insightWhile Indiana doesn't have specific home warranty laws, the Indiana Department of Insurance informally regulates companies, requiring a backup insurance policy. You can file complaints with the Federal Trade Commission (FTC).
Jump to insightThe national average cost for a home warranty is $350 to $900 per year as of July 2025, but how much you’ll end up paying depends on the norm in your part of Indiana, as well as the company and plan you choose. Home warranty companies sometimes offer ways to save, like bundling plans or opting for a higher service call fee.
To gather the cost estimates below, we received quotes for several tiers of coverage from 22 home warranty companies.
Type of cost | Cost range |
---|---|
Basic coverage | $30 to $89 per month |
Comprehensive coverage | $40 to $99 per month |
Service fee | $75 to $150 per claim |
Indiana experiences a wide range of weather conditions, from hot summers to cold winters, which can put stress on your home’s systems and appliances. Towns like Indianapolis, Fort Wayne and Bloomington can see significant temperature swings, meaning a warranty with HVAC coverage might be a smart idea.

Usually, the regulation of home warranties falls under the jurisdiction of the Indiana Department of Insurance (IDOI). Indiana doesn't have a specific law for home or appliance service contracts, though. In the past, the Indiana Department of Insurance (DOI) ruled that these programs don’t need to follow insurance laws — however, the companies are informally regulated by an old rule that requires these programs to have a backup insurance policy.
If you would like to file a complaint against a home warranty company in Indiana, your best bet would be to contact the Federal Trade Commission (FTC).
A home warranty is worth it to many homeowners for peace of mind, but this depends on your financial situation, the state of your appliances and several other factors. If a repair or replacement for a home system or appliance could break you, it might be worth shelling out the monthly payment for coverage.
Unlike homeowners insurance, a home warranty isn’t a requirement for taking out a mortgage. Home warranties cover various home appliances and systems in the event they break down due to regular use; homeowners insurance, on the other hand, covers your property and belongings if they’re destroyed in an accident (like a fire or bad weather).
Typically, the seller pays for the home warranty if it's offered as part of the contract. However, if the seller doesn’t offer a warranty, it's up to the buyer to purchase the coverage they want. If you’re already a homeowner, you’d typically pay for your own coverage.
